Criteria Air Pollutant

As regulated under National Ambient Air Quality Standards (NAAQS), six air pollutants the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) has designated as hazardous to human health. The EPA has set maximum legally allowable concentrations for these six pollutants:
  • Nitrogen oxide.
  • Lead.
  • Sulfur dioxide.
  • Total suspended particulates.
  • Carbon monoxide.
  • Ozone.
